We manage sourcing, inspection and export logistics from the factory floor in Asia through to the Port of Tema, including export documentation. Once your shipment arrives, we connect you directly with a licensed Ghanaian clearing and transport partner who handles customs clearance, duty/VAT payment, and last-mile delivery to your business — billed and paid directly between you and them.

Landed cost is where most first-time Ghanaian importers get surprised — not by the factory price, but by everything added on top of it at the border. Here's the real math on a shipment from China into Tema, so there are no surprises when your container lands.
| Item | Rate / Range |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Import Duty | 0% – 35% of CIF value | Most categories fall between 5–20% |
| VAT | 15% of subtotal | Applied after other levies |
| NHIL + GETFund Levy | 2.5% + 2.5% of subtotal | National Health Insurance & education fund levies |
| Processing Fee + ECOWAS + AU Levy | 1% + 0.5% + 0.2% of CIF | Regional trade and processing levies |
| Sea Freight (20GP / 40GP) | Moderate–high, varies by carrier & season | China to Tema — we quote current rates with every project |
| Customs Clearance | 3–14 business days | Green channel: 3–7 days · Red channel (physical inspection): +7–14 days |
Ghana's landed cost stacks several smaller levies on top of duty and VAT — easy to underestimate if you're pricing a shipment for the first time. We build all of them into your quote upfront so your margin calculation is accurate before you commit.
